AI Technical Summary
In joint space-ground data processing, pseudorange bias leads to a decrease in the accuracy of real-time clock difference estimation for navigation satellites, and existing technologies are unable to effectively eliminate this effect.
By constructing multi-source observation data models from ground stations and low-orbit satellites, the pseudorange bias value of the receiver is calculated and corrected. Combined with Kalman filtering, the navigation satellite clock bias is estimated in real time to eliminate the influence of pseudorange bias.
It improves the accuracy of real-time clock difference estimation for navigation satellites, resolves the adverse effects of pseudorange bias on estimation accuracy, and enhances the performance of real-time precise positioning services.
